Out among the Fremdly faces
This morning, I got to read and talk to these students at Fremd High School in Palatine, IL…
…and these students…
…and these students:
Fremd puts on an amazing program annually known as Writers Week. You can learn a lot more about it here, but suffice to say, it’s a seriously awesome event. Before I went on (and showed the audience a very tiny picture of Elisa Gabbert, my collaborator, from That Tiny Insane Voluptuousness)….
…I listened to a presentation by YA author Robin Wasserman…
…and after I went on, I enjoyed the hospitality of the Hospitality Room. In addition to more baked goods than you could shake a stick at, the room had many words of wisdom to offer, including these:
…and these:
Thanks to Dan “Danger” Hays and Tony Romano for inviting me, and thanks to all the students pictured above for being such killer listeners and for asking such fun questions.
